Major differences

Plaza Flamingo operates on a different scale than its larger counterparts. While you can certainly find souvenirs here, the selection pales in comparison to the vast array of international and local brands at Plaza Las Americas or the trendy boutiques lining La Isla Cancún. Food options at Plaza Flamingo are minimal, often limited to small snack bars, a stark contrast to the extensive food courts and diverse restaurants found at Plaza Las Americas and La Isla Cancún.

Beach access is non-existent at Plaza Flamingo; it is purely a commercial hub. Marina Puerto Cancún, on the other hand, offers an upscale experience with high-end retailers and waterfront dining, a world away from the bartering culture typical at Plaza Flamingo. The atmosphere at Plaza Flamingo is more functional, geared towards quick purchases, whereas La Isla Cancún buzzes with activity, including its iconic Ferris wheel, and Plaza Las Americas offers a more traditional, air-conditioned mall environment.

Who each suits

Plaza Flamingo is best suited for the traveler who needs to tick off the souvenir box quickly and cheaply. If your priority is finding a basic t-shirt or a small decorative item without spending much, this is your spot. La Isla Cancún appeals to families and couples looking for a lively atmosphere with entertainment options alongside shopping.

Plaza Las Americas is the go-to for those who prefer a conventional, air-conditioned mall experience with a wide range of familiar brands and a solid supermarket. Marina Puerto Cancún caters to the luxury shopper seeking designer labels and a sophisticated dining scene. CENTRO MAYA offers a more local mall feel, less crowded than the major tourist hubs, with a mix of everyday stores.

Local knowledge

Bartering Basics

At Plaza Flamingo, expect to haggle. Start your offer at around 50-60% of the initial asking price and be prepared to meet somewhere in the middle. Don't be afraid to walk away if the price isn't right; vendors often call you back with a better offer.

Beyond Souvenirs

While known for souvenirs, keep an eye out for local artisan crafts. Sometimes smaller, less tourist-centric shops within Plaza Flamingo might have unique items not found in the larger malls, offering a different kind of value.

Location Advantage

Plaza Flamingo's location in the Hotel Zone makes it accessible via public bus, which is a very affordable way to get around Cancun. This keeps your overall travel costs down, enhancing its value proposition for budget-conscious visitors.

Frequently asked

Is Plaza Flamingo a better value than its direct rivals in Cancun?

Plaza Flamingo offers better value if your primary goal is acquiring inexpensive souvenirs and you are comfortable with a limited selection and a no-frills environment. Its rivals, such as La Isla Cancún and Plaza Las Americas, provide a more comprehensive shopping and entertainment experience, which can represent better overall value for travelers seeking more than just basic mementos.

Which alternative shopping center beats Plaza Flamingo on price?

Generally, no other major shopping center in Cancun consistently beats Plaza Flamingo on the absolute lowest prices for basic souvenirs. Its value lies in its simplicity and focus on budget items. However, outlets like Las Plazas Outlet Cancun might offer better deals on specific branded clothing if that is your focus.

Where does Plaza Flamingo still win on value?

Plaza Flamingo wins on value for travelers who prioritize the lowest possible cost for generic souvenirs and are willing to forgo extensive selection or amenities. It's a straightforward place to find a few trinkets without the pressure or expense of larger, more elaborate shopping complexes in Cancun.

Which type of traveler should pick a rival over Plaza Flamingo?

Travelers seeking a diverse range of international brands, a wide variety of dining options, entertainment, or a more modern and comfortable shopping environment should opt for rivals like Plaza Las Americas or La Isla Cancún. Families looking for activities and couples wanting a more upscale experience will also find better value elsewhere.

What hidden costs change the value math at Plaza Flamingo?

The primary 'hidden cost' affecting the value at Plaza Flamingo isn't monetary but experiential. While prices for goods might be low, the lack of diverse food options means you'll likely need to travel elsewhere for meals, incurring additional transportation or dining costs. The limited selection also means you might end up visiting multiple places to find what you need, negating potential savings.
